/**************************************************************************/
|
|
|
|
#ifdef _RWSTD_OS_LINUX
|
|
|
|
// use siglongjmp() and sigsetjmp() on Linux to avoid
|
|
// http://sourceware.org/bugzilla/show_bug.cgi?id=2351
|
|
# include <setjmp.h> // for siglongjmp, sigsetjmp
|
|
|
|
jmp_buf jmp_env;
|
|
|
|
extern "C" {
|
|
|
|
void handle_fpe (int)
|
|
{
|
|
siglongjmp (jmp_env, 1);
|
|
}
|
|
|
|
} // extern "C"
|
|
|
|
# define RW_SIGSETJMP(env, signo) sigsetjmp (env, signo)
|
|
#else // if !defined (_RWSTD_OS_LINUX)
|
|
|
|
# include <csetjmp> // for longjmp, setjmp
|
|
|
|
std::jmp_buf jmp_env;
|
|
|
|
extern "C" {
|
|
|
|
void handle_fpe (int)
|
|
{
|
|
std::longjmp (jmp_env, 1);
|
|
}
|
|
|
|
} // extern "C"
|
|
# define RW_SIGSETJMP(env, ignore) setjmp (env)
|
|
#endif // _RWSTD_OS_LINUX
|
|
|
|
|
|
/**************************************************************************/
|
|
|
|
#ifdef _MSC_VER
|
|
// silence useless MSVC warnings:
|
|
// 4800: 'int' : forcing value to bool 'true' or 'false'
|
|
// 4804: '/' : unsafe use of type 'bool' in operation
|
|
# pragma warning (disable: 4800 4804)
|
|
|
|
// use Structured Exception Handling to detect arithmetic exceptions
|
|
# define TRY __try
|
|
# define EXCEPT(arg) __except (arg)
|
|
#else
|
|
# define TRY if (1)
|
|
# define EXCEPT(ignore) else if (0)
|
|
#endif // _MSC_VER
|
|
|
|
|
|
template <class numT>
|
|
inline void
|
|
try_trap (const volatile numT &one, const volatile numT &zero,
|
|
numT &result, bool &trapped)
|
|
{
|
|
TRY {
|
|
result = one / zero;
|
|
}
|
|
EXCEPT (1) {
|
|
// Windows SEH hackery
|
|
trapped = true;
|
|
}
|
|
}
|
|
|
|
|
|
template <class numT>
|
|
numT test_traps (numT, int lineno, bool)
|
|
{
|
|
static const char* const tname = rw_any_t (numT ()).type_name ();
|
|
|
|
if (!rw_enabled (tname)) {
|
|
rw_note (0, 0, 0, "numeric_limits<%s>::traps test disabled", tname);
|
|
return numT ();
|
|
}
|
|
|
|
const bool traps = std::numeric_limits<numT>::traps;
|
|
|
|
rw_info (0, 0, 0, "std::numeric_limits<%s>::traps = %b", tname, traps);
|
|
|
|
#ifdef SIGFPE
|
|
std::signal (SIGFPE, handle_fpe);
|
|
#else // if !defined (SIGFPE)
|
|
if (!rw_warn (!traps, 0, lineno,
|
|
"SIGFPE not #defined and numeric_limits<%s>::traps == %b, "
|
|
"cannot test", tname, traps)) {
|
|
return numT ();
|
|
}
|
|
#endif // SIGFPE
|
|
|
|
numT result = numT ();
|
|
|
|
// set the environment
|
|
const int jumped = RW_SIGSETJMP (jmp_env, SIGFPE);
|
|
|
|
volatile numT zero = numT (jumped);
|
|
volatile numT one = numT (1);
|
|
|
|
bool trapped = false;
|
|
|
|
if (jumped) {
|
|
// setjmp() call above returned from the SIGFPE handler
|
|
// as a result of a floating point exception triggered
|
|
// by the division by zero in the else block below
|
|
result = zero / one;
|
|
|
|
trapped = true;
|
|
}
|
|
else {
|
|
// setjmp() call above returned after setting up the jump
|
|
// environment; see of division by zero traps (if so, it
|
|
// will generate a SIGFPE which will be caught by the
|
|
// signal hanlder above and execution will resume by
|
|
// returning from setjmp() above again, but this time
|
|
// with a non-zero value
|
|
try_trap (one, zero, result, trapped);
|
|
}
|
|
|
|
rw_assert (trapped == traps, 0, lineno,
|
|
"numeric_limits<%s>::traps == %b, got %b",
|
|
tname, trapped, traps);
|
|
|
|
return result;
|
|
}
